Overview
- At a Parramatta launch, David Warner predicted a 4-0 series win for Australia and said England were playing for a 'moral victory'.
- Stuart Broad, speaking on the Love of Cricket podcast, said Australia have their weakest Ashes team since 2010 and England their strongest since then.
- Broad argued the greater pressure sits with Australia because they are expected to win at home.
- Pre-series analysis highlights Australian selection and fitness questions, including who opens with Usman Khawaja, Marnus Labuschagne’s form at No. 3, and captain Pat Cummins’ workload after a back injury.
- The first Test is scheduled to begin on November 21 at Optus Stadium in Perth.
